About Dexter:
He's smart, he's good looking, and he's got a great sense of humor. He's Dexter Morgan, everyone's favorite serial killer. As a Miami forensics expert, he spends his days solving crimes, and nights committing them. But Dexter lives by a strict code of honor that is both his saving grace and lifelong burden. Torn between his deadly compulsion and his desire for true happiness, Dexter is a man in profound conflict with the world and himself. Golden Globe winner Michael C. Hall stars in the hit SHOWTIME Original Series.

I think the point to the Caldwell character was to show the audience that Dexter is no different. Dexter even says this to Deb. "Kurt is nothing like me". Only to find out he was a serial killer too. The only difference is we know Dexter and like him... Yet the show makes it a point to show them and how similar they are in their desire to kill.
Kurt -
1. Had a son who's relationship was strained and in the end was a disappointment to him. He lied on him to protect his own secret.
2. Lied about Matt's whereabouts to cover his tracks.
3. Had a ritual in which he captured and preserved his trophies/kills.
4. Became extremely angry when his kill/ritual was disrupted. (Girl he shot in the eye)
5. Was friendly, the whole town knew him and was such a nice guy.
6. Had a code - Protect women from the dangers of the outside world.
7. Thought of himself as a hero.
8. In the end didn't care about protecting the women.. Only the hunt, capture, kill, to feed the darkness inside.
Dexter -
1. Had a son he abandon, who's relationship was strained. Was going to abandon him again, to protect himself.
2. Shut down at any conversation with Harrison about why he left. Was too busy covering his tracks of killing Matt.
3. Had a ritual in which he captured, killed his victims collecting trophies. (The plastic kill room and blood slides)
4. Became extremely angry when his kill/ritual was disrupted. (Drug dealer/Logan coming to the house)
5. Was friendly & brought donuts to co-workers, the whole town knew him and was such a nice guy. So helpful.
6. Had a code - Don't get caught. Only kill those that slip through the justice system.
7. Thought of himself as a hero ( Dark Defender)
8. In the end didn't care about protecting the innocent from the Kurt's of the world. Only the hunt, capture, kill, to feed the darkness passenger.
Through out the entire show.. Dexter and Kurt mirrored one another... Dexter talks about how much he wants to take care of and raise Harrison... Yet, when faced with actually bonding with Harrison, he left to kill people or try and cover his own tracks (Just like Kurt did with Matt). The only time Dexter really tried with Harrison, is when he thought his dark passenger was the same as his... He was teaching Harrison how to kill and get away with it, so they could be a "team". To the point, Kurt even say's " I wish my son was more like H here". He was so excited to have Harrison be just like him. Even said it "You're just like me buddy".
No Dexter, Harrison still has time to seek real therapy.. He didn't understand where all his anger was coming from. Until he got the full picture to who his father was... Now with that knowledge he can work through it... By the time Dexter had remembered all of what happened to him as a child, it was too late.. Harry's Code didn't help the situation.. but... it did however prevent Dexter from killing the innocent. Until it didn't... like with Logan... the first rule is "Don't get caught".

I don't get why everyone is down on the finale. The biggest problem with the way the series ended is that Dexter never faced the consequences of his actions and kept not having to make the tough, moral decisions. He killed a good man in that final episode for the sake of his code and paid the consequences for it. The whole point of this final season was to illustrate that Dexter wasn't really a good person nor a hero. Yes, he killed bad guys, but we saw time and time again, when truly good people got in his way, he wouldn't hesitate to take them out. He got both Doakes and LaGuerta killed to avoid getting caught. He killed two innocent men across his journey and never faced the consequences for it. And in being who he is, he got Rita and Deb killed, orphaned his step children, and destroyed Harrison's life.
Killing Logan, a truly good and kind man whose death was a result of his kindness towards Dex, so bluntly and cruelly, was the final straw. Dexter was no different than the killers he hunted. For the most part, he could direct his bloodlust at the right people, but any who stood in his way wouldn't last, and Harrison wasn't about to have that. Especially not after what his life was reduced to because of Dex.
